How do I power an amp from a wall outlet?
I have upgraded my car system so i don’t need my old subs and amp. I want have my amp power my subs, but I need the amp to be able to be plugged in to an wall outlet. I plan on using these for my football team’s locker room.
Any suggestions will be great. Thx
You will have to obtain a regulated DC Power Supply capable of delivering enough continuous current for however much the amplifier draws. Look at the fuses that comes in the amp if you don’t have the actual specifications to go by. If it has just one 35-amp fuse, make sure the power supply is rated at least 35-amps continuous. If it has two 35-amp fuses, that’s 70 amps, etc.
These can be quite expensive. Another alternative is to get a deep-cycle marine battery and charge it up, then use it until it’s low. You usually can’t leave a battery charger on it while it’s working because chargers aren’t filtered well and you will get a lot of hum.
